Putney Park Estate : auction sale, 17th November, 1928
DETAILS
Creator/sPeach Bros. AuctioneersPublished Date1928DescriptionMap shows Union Street, now called McGowan Street.
Map shows Putney Point Park, now called Putney Park.
Map shows the route and a sketch drawing of the Mortlake to Putney free government punt.
Map shows the Mortlake bus and tram terminus with the note 'Sydney Railway Station 45 mins'.
Map shows Putney Point Hall.
Includes picture of the Putney Punt, view of Putney Park Estate showing the absolute water frontages, the Walker Convalescent home, "Yaralla" (home of Miss Eadith Walker, a panorama photograph of Tennyson from Putney Park Estate.
Also titled Putney "the peaceful"
